Merengue is the national music of the Dominican Republic, developed as accompaniment to the folk dance of the same name as far back as the mid-19th century. In its traditional form -- known as merengue tipico -- merengue was a vocal-driven dance music that reflected the blending of Spanish and African cultural influences.

Joseíto Mateo, Primitivo Santos, and Alberto Beltrán became the first artists to perform merengue at Madison Square Garden in 1967, a major milestone for the genre’s popularity in the United States.

Merenhouse, merenrap or electronic merengue is a hip hop music style formed by blending Dominican merengue music with rap, dancehall reggae and hip hop. The mix of Latin music, house music and dancehall started in NYC in the late 80's. Merenhouse usually combines a rap style of singing (talk-singing) with actual singing. Merengue, French mérengue, couple dance originating in the Dominican Republic and Haiti, strongly influenced by Venezuelan and Afro-Cuban musical practices and by dances throughout Latin America.Originally, and still, a rural folk dance and later a ballroom dance, the merengue is at its freest away from the ballroom.It is danced with a limping step, the weight always on the same foot.
